What is email filtering? 

Email filtering refers to the process of analyzing incoming emails and applying specific rules to determine their legitimacy and potential risk. Email filters automatically sort, categorize, and prioritize emails based on predefined criteria. The primary objective of email filtering is to ensure that only safe and relevant messages reach users’ inboxes, while keeping malicious or unwanted content at bay.

How does email filtering work?

Email filtering uses a combination of techniques to assess the content, sender, and other attributes of incoming emails. These techniques include for example:

  • Blacklisting:

    Blacklists include a list of domains or IP addresses associated with malicious or unwanted senders. Emails from these senders are automatically blocked or filtered to prevent them from reaching the user’s inbox. 
  • Content filtering:

  • Reputation-based filtering:

    This filtering method assigns a reputation score to emails based on factors such as IP addresses and past actions of the sender. Email filters typically block messages with low reputation scores and prevent them from reaching a user’s inbox.
  • Whitelisting:

    While blacklisting prevents users from receiving messages from a specific sender, whitelisting does the opposite. Emails from senders on the whitelist are always delivered regardless of the content of their messages.
  • Bayesian filtering:

    Bayesian filtering prevents spam from reaching a user’s inbox using a statistical model. This method of filtering evolves over time as the filter learns to distinguish between legitimate and spam messages.
  • Language filtering:

    Language filtering blocks emails written in a foreign language and prevents them from reaching a user’s inbox.
